What is the angular acceleration of a particle if the angular velocity of a particle becomes `4` times of its initial angular velocity `1` rad s in `2` seconds |
|
Answer» Using `alpha=(omega-omega_(0))/(t)` `alpha=(4-1)/(2)=(3)/(2)rad//s^(2)` Hint : `alpha = (omega - omega_(0))/(t)` |
